What happened?

AI company Anthropic is planning to implement invisible watermarks in text generated by its Claude models. The technique relies on subtle patterns in word and character choice that are imperceptible to human readers but can be identified by specialised scanning tools. The purpose is to make it possible to track and verify whether a text was created by AI.

Why it matters

The rapidly growing abundance of AI-generated text on the internet is creating problems for search engines, educational systems, and publishers alike. By integrating invisible watermarks, Anthropic is aiming to meet increasing demands for transparency and responsible AI development, while the industry seeks standards for distinguishing human-created content from automated text.

Who is affected?

The measure affects anyone who uses Anthropic's services and models, including developers, writers, students, and businesses. Furthermore, it impacts platforms, publishers, and educational institutions looking to identify AI-generated content or prevent the spread of so-called AI slop.

Impact on the EU

Watermarking techniques for AI-generated text align with the requirements of the EU AI Act, which mandates transparency and traceability for AI-generated content. As Anthropic is developing the solution for global use, it is expected to cover all users within the EU.

What else you should know

Watermarking text has historically been more difficult than for images and audio, as text can easily be modified or rephrased by users, which can compromise the invisible structure. It remains to be seen how resilient Anthropic's methods will be against such edits.
